top of page
James McDonald






James McDonald RSW
Contemporary Scottish Artist
Contact
January 2025
This site is currently under construction - please check back soon.

bottom of page
James McDonald
Contemporary Scottish Artist
January 2025
This site is currently under construction - please check back soon.